Understanding the Two Main Types of City E-Bikes
Electric bicycles designed for urban use generally fall into two categories: commuter e-bikes and cargo e-bikes. While both are built for city riding, they serve different purposes and come with distinct setups.
Commuter E-Bikes: Built for Speed and Efficiency
Commuter electric bicycles prioritize agility, comfort, and efficiency over long distances. They’re typically lightweight, with a step-through or traditional frame, and are ideal for riders covering 5 to 15 miles daily. These bikes often feature integrated lights, fenders, and rear racks—standard for city commuting.
- Weight: Usually between 40–55 pounds, making them easier to handle at traffic lights or on public transit.
- Battery Range: 30–60 miles on a single charge, depending on assist level and terrain.
- Tires: Narrower (1.75″–2.2″) for reduced rolling resistance on pavement.
- Motor Power: Typically 250W–500W, sufficient for flat city routes with occasional hills.
For example, the RadCity 5 Plus offers a balanced setup with a 60-mile range, hydraulic disc brakes, and a rear rack that supports up to 55 pounds—ideal for carrying a backpack or small groceries.
Cargo E-Bikes: Designed for Heavy Loads and Stability
Cargo electric bicycles are built to carry more—whether it’s groceries, packages, or children. They come in two main styles: longtails (extended rear rack) and front-loaders (box-style cargo area). These bikes are heavier and longer, but offer unmatched utility for urban families and delivery riders.
- Weight: Often 60–80 pounds or more, requiring stronger frames and brakes.
- Cargo Capacity: 100–400 pounds, depending on model and configuration.
- Battery Range: 20–50 miles, as heavier loads drain the battery faster.
- Motor Power: 500W–750W to handle added weight and maintain speed.
The Yuba Mundo longtail, for instance, supports up to 440 pounds with optional child seats and panniers, making it a favorite among parents in dense neighborhoods.
Key Differences When Riding on City Streets
City riding presents unique challenges—narrow bike lanes, frequent stops, traffic congestion, and variable road surfaces. How each e-bike type handles these conditions can make or break your daily experience.
Maneuverability and Parking
Commuter e-bikes excel in tight spaces. Their shorter wheelbase and lighter build make them easy to weave through traffic, lock to bike racks, or carry upstairs. In contrast, cargo e-bikes require more space to turn and park. A front-loader may need a dedicated parking spot or secure outdoor storage due to its width.
Tip: If you live in an apartment without bike storage, a commuter e-bike is often the more practical choice.
Stopping Power and Safety
Both types should have hydraulic disc brakes, but cargo e-bikes place greater demand on braking systems due to their weight. Look for models with dual-piston calipers and regenerative braking features where available. Always test braking distance with a full load before relying on the bike daily.
Hill Climbing and Motor Performance
Even flat cities have inclines—think bridges, overpasses, or cobblestone ramps. Commuter e-bikes usually handle these with ease, but cargo models may require a mid-drive motor for better weight distribution and torque. Hub motors are common but can struggle under heavy load on steep grades.
Example: A cargo e-bike with a 750W mid-drive motor (like the Riese & Müller Load 75) climbs hills more efficiently than a 500W hub motor model, especially when carrying two children and groceries.
Setting Up Your E-Bike for City Riding
Regardless of type, proper setup ensures safety, comfort, and longevity. Here’s how to optimize your electric bicycle for daily city use.
1. Adjust the Saddle and Handlebars
A comfortable riding position reduces fatigue and improves control. For commuter e-bikes, a slightly upright posture helps with visibility in traffic. Cargo e-bikes benefit from a relaxed, stable stance to manage weight distribution.
- Set saddle height so your leg is nearly straight at the bottom of the pedal stroke.
- Adjust handlebar height to avoid excessive reach or strain.
- Use ergonomic grips to reduce hand fatigue on long rides.
2. Install Essential Accessories
City riding demands visibility and utility. Add these accessories based on your e-bike type:
| Accessory | Commuter E-Bike | Cargo E-Bike |
|---|---|---|
| Front & Rear Lights | Essential for visibility | Critical due to lower speed and bulk |
| Fenders | Recommended for wet weather | Must-have to protect cargo and rider |
| Rear Rack / Panniers | Standard for bags and groceries | Often pre-installed; expandable |
| Child Seat or Cargo Box | Rarely used | Common and often integrated |
| Bell or Horn | Useful for alerting pedestrians | Necessary for navigating crowded areas |
3. Tire Pressure and Maintenance
Proper tire pressure affects range, comfort, and puncture resistance. Check pressure weekly—city streets have debris, potholes, and curbs that can damage underinflated tires.
- Commuter e-bikes: Inflate to 50–70 PSI for speed and efficiency.
- Cargo e-bikes: Use 40–60 PSI for better grip and load support.
Warning: Overinflating tires on a cargo e-bike can reduce traction and increase the risk of skidding, especially in wet conditions.
4. Battery Care and Charging Habits
City riders often charge daily. To extend battery life:
- Avoid draining the battery below 10% regularly.
- Store the battery indoors in extreme temperatures.
- Use the manufacturer’s charger—third-party chargers can damage cells.
Most e-bike batteries last 500–1,000 charge cycles. With daily use, expect 2–4 years of reliable performance before capacity noticeably declines.
Choosing the Right E-Bike for Your City Lifestyle
Your decision should align with how you use the bike. Ask yourself:
- Do I mostly ride alone, or do I transport people or goods regularly?
- How far is my typical trip, and are there hills?
- Where will I store the bike overnight?
- Do I need to carry it upstairs or onto public transit?
If you answer “yes” to carrying kids, large grocery loads, or making frequent deliveries, a cargo e-bike is likely worth the extra weight and cost. For solo riders covering moderate distances with light loads, a commuter e-bike offers better speed, agility, and convenience.
Common Mistakes to Avoid
Even experienced riders make setup errors that compromise safety or performance.
Ignoring Local E-Bike Laws
Most cities classify e-bikes into three categories based on speed and motor power. Ensure your bike complies with local regulations—some areas restrict Class 3 e-bikes (28 mph) from bike paths or require helmets.
Overloading the Rack
Exceeding the manufacturer’s weight limit can damage the frame, warp the rear wheel, or cause brake failure. Always check the specs—especially on commuter e-bikes with lighter racks.
Skipping Regular Maintenance
Chain lubrication, brake checks, and bolt tightening should be done monthly. Cargo e-bikes, due to higher usage and weight, benefit from professional servicing every 6 months.

FAQ
Can I use a cargo e-bike for daily commuting if I don’t carry heavy loads?
Yes, but it may be overkill. Cargo e-bikes are heavier and less agile, which can make short trips feel sluggish. Only choose one if you anticipate needing cargo capacity regularly.
Are commuter e-bikes safe for riding in heavy traffic?
Yes, especially models with integrated lights, reflective elements, and responsive brakes. Always wear a helmet, use hand signals, and stay visible—especially at intersections.
How do I secure a cargo e-bike against theft in the city?
Use a high-quality U-lock through the frame and rear wheel, and consider a secondary cable for the front wheel and accessories. Park in well-lit, high-traffic areas, and remove the battery when possible.
